SSO de Android Facebook para la autenticación de servidor
Estoy usando FB SSO para una aplicación de Android y me gustaría usar la ID de Facebook para autenticar a mis usuarios cuando suben datos a mi servidor. Me imagino que debería enviar el token de OAuth al hacer la llamada al servidor. ¿Hay algún ejemplo que me ayude a empezar?
Gracias por cualquier puntero.
- La previsualización de la imagen de Facebook solo falta cuando compartes desde Android
- NoClassDefFoundError al usar Parse.com para iniciar sesión en Facebook
- Facebook Android SDK Invalid_key
- Facebook share - Textos que faltan
- Obtener permisos de lectura y publicación en una solicitud
- API de Android Facebook - enviar una invitación de aplicación a un amigo
- Facebook "Messenger" tiene un SMS Broadcast Receiver que tiene la máxima prioridad después de reiniciar
- Redireccionar a los usuarios a la tienda de aplicaciones de iTunes oa la tienda de Google Play Store?
- ¿Cómo puedo iniciar sesión con facebook y obtener información de usuario para enviar mi db remoto desde la aplicación android
- Realizar solicitudes REST autorizadas (a través de facebook) a mi servidor node.js en una aplicación PhoneGap
- Instalando el plugin facebook de phonegap
- Compartir en Facebook en android (como twitter)
- Cómo utilizar el parámetro de paquete de paso para la paginación en el desarrollo de facebook android
He enfrentado el mismo problema hace un tiempo. Al final, lo hice usando la siguiente manera:
Recibo el token a través de Facebook Android SDK y lo paso a mi servidor con la dirección de correo electrónico de los usuarios y el ID de Facebook. El servidor intenta obtener la dirección de correo electrónico del usuario utilizando el token. Si las direcciones de correo electrónico coinciden, el usuario se ha autenticado.
¿Puede aclarar más, desea autenticar usuario en su servidor a través de ID de Facebook? El token de acceso recibido a través de SSO le permitirá llamar apis de grafos, consulta FQL, etc. que pueden requerir permisos especiales dependiendo de lo que desee hacer.
Más información sobre Android SDK: https://developers.facebook.com/docs/guides/mobile/#android
Más información sobre Permiso: https://developers.facebook.com/docs/reference/api/permissions/
- No se ha encontrado actividad para manejar la acción intencional.
- Android imeOptions = "actionDone" no funciona